Ogero services go down in Tripoli

BEIRUT — Lebanon's public fixed-line telephone and internet provider Ogero announced an ongoing outage on Friday at its Tripoli transmission station in North Lebanon, following "a power surge on the generators."

The outage has brought the service to a halt in the affected localities and surrounding areas, Ogero added on its Twitter account.

Maintenance teams are working to repair the fault, the utility said.

Ogero's network has regularly experienced such breakdowns since the onset of the economic crisis, notably due to a lack of electricity supply or equipment theft.
